Full report

1 min read · 131 words
Thai authorities said on Thursday they are searching for the people responsible for an attack in the country’s troubled deep south region that killed five soldiers and injured several civilians.About 10 attackers opened fire and threw pipe bombs at soldiers at a security checkpoint near a residential area in Narathiwat province on Wednesday evening before fleeing, according to the regional Internal Security Operations Command. Six civilians were injured during the attack, including a 10-year-old boy who remains hospitalised in stable condition.Photos released by authorities showed a group identified as the attackers, dressed in black clothing and hats and riding on the back of a black pickup truck at around 6.45pm. Security officials said the truck was later found abandoned and set on fire about 21km (13 miles) away from the scene.
